Overview
A journey from the swirl of Marrakech's souks to the silence of the dunes. You'll cross the High Atlas on one of the world's great mountain roads, spend a night in a kasbah hotel, then ride camels into the Erg Chebbi dunes for two nights under a sky you will not believe. It's adventurous in the best sense — nowhere dangerous, everywhere extraordinary.
Day by day
Day 1
Meet at the airport and check into a riad hidden in the medina's maze of lanes.
Day 2
Souks with a local guide who knows every doorway, then a rooftop mint-tea moment over Jemaa el-Fnaa.
Day 3
The Tizi n'Tichka pass, kasbah villages and an overnight stop at a restored fortress hotel.
Day 4
Ouarzazate, the Dades Valley and the road of a thousand curves to the desert's edge.
Day 5
Camel trek at golden hour, then a night in a luxury desert camp with dinner under the stars.
Day 6
Sunrise over the dunes, a 4x4 run along the borderlands, and one last Berber camp night.
Day 7
A long, beautiful drive home through the mountains, arriving in time for a final dinner.
